最近在调试一款Phy的驱动,从没有任何头绪到略有了解经历了太多的痛苦,于是决定写这个系列篇记录一下。特别感谢无数优秀的博主无私奉献很多优秀的博文给予了我很大的帮助。在这个系列篇中,我也会转载部分优秀的博文(会附上链接),以及增添自己的理解,如果部分内容有侵权的地方,麻烦联系我。概述管理MII接口的MDIO接口是一个双线的串行接口,用来对PHY芯片等物理层信息进行操作管理。MDIO的历史MDIO是ManagementDataInput/Output的缩写,有两根线,分别为双向的MDIO和单向的MDC,用于以太网设备中上层对物理层的管理。之所以能够管理这些PHY芯片,是因为能够对PHY芯片的各类
最近在调试一款Phy的驱动,从没有任何头绪到略有了解经历了太多的痛苦,于是决定写这个系列篇记录一下。特别感谢无数优秀的博主无私奉献很多优秀的博文给予了我很大的帮助。在这个系列篇中,我也会转载部分优秀的博文(会附上链接),以及增添自己的理解,如果部分内容有侵权的地方,麻烦联系我。概述管理MII接口的MDIO接口是一个双线的串行接口,用来对PHY芯片等物理层信息进行操作管理。MDIO的历史MDIO是ManagementDataInput/Output的缩写,有两根线,分别为双向的MDIO和单向的MDC,用于以太网设备中上层对物理层的管理。之所以能够管理这些PHY芯片,是因为能够对PHY芯片的各类
在OIer.Space上阅读|在洛谷上阅读Part0题意简述原题给出拥有的金属数量与金属配方,求金属\(N\)最大能合成的数量。Part1题目分析首先,金属\(i\)能配出的最大数量只和它的原数量和它的配方中能合成的数量有关。所以我们应该能想到递归,可以使用一个bool类型的递归函数来返回合成是否可行:如果有金属\(i\),返回可行并减去一份金属\(i\);如果没有金属\(i\)且没有配方,则返回不可行如果没有金属\(i\)有配方就递归配方所需金属\(r\);有任一不可行,返回不可行;所有可行,返回可行。Part2代码根据上方分析,可以写出递归函数://vectorrecipe[100+20]
在OIer.Space上阅读|在洛谷上阅读Part0题意简述原题给出拥有的金属数量与金属配方,求金属\(N\)最大能合成的数量。Part1题目分析首先,金属\(i\)能配出的最大数量只和它的原数量和它的配方中能合成的数量有关。所以我们应该能想到递归,可以使用一个bool类型的递归函数来返回合成是否可行:如果有金属\(i\),返回可行并减去一份金属\(i\);如果没有金属\(i\)且没有配方,则返回不可行如果没有金属\(i\)有配方就递归配方所需金属\(r\);有任一不可行,返回不可行;所有可行,返回可行。Part2代码根据上方分析,可以写出递归函数://vectorrecipe[100+20]
#安装rpm编译环境 dnfinstall-yrpm-buildvimgccgcc-c++glibcglibc-developenssl-developensslpcrepcre-develzlibzlib-develmakewgetkrb5-develpam-devellibX11-develxmkmflibXt-develinitscriptslibXt-develimakegtk2-devellrzsz--downloadonly--downloaddir=/opt/software/package/rpm-buildrpm-Uvh--force--nodeps/opt/software
#安装rpm编译环境 dnfinstall-yrpm-buildvimgccgcc-c++glibcglibc-developenssl-developensslpcrepcre-develzlibzlib-develmakewgetkrb5-develpam-devellibX11-develxmkmflibXt-develinitscriptslibXt-develimakegtk2-devellrzsz--downloadonly--downloaddir=/opt/software/package/rpm-buildrpm-Uvh--force--nodeps/opt/software
摘要:《IndexCheckpointsforInstantRecoveryinIn-MemoryDatabaseSystems》是由华为云数据库创新Lab一作发表在数据库领域顶级会议VLDB'2022的学术论文。本文分享自华为云社区《VLDB'22HiEngine极致RTO论文解读》,作者:云数据库创新Lab。1.HiEngine简介HiEngine是华为云自研的一款面向云原生环境的OLTP型数据库,HiEngine在标准TPC-C事务模型下,端到端单节点(华为2488HV5机型)性能可以达到663w+的tpmC,多节点扩展性线性度超过0.8。其核心架构关键词如下:计算,内存,存储三层分离式
摘要:《IndexCheckpointsforInstantRecoveryinIn-MemoryDatabaseSystems》是由华为云数据库创新Lab一作发表在数据库领域顶级会议VLDB'2022的学术论文。本文分享自华为云社区《VLDB'22HiEngine极致RTO论文解读》,作者:云数据库创新Lab。1.HiEngine简介HiEngine是华为云自研的一款面向云原生环境的OLTP型数据库,HiEngine在标准TPC-C事务模型下,端到端单节点(华为2488HV5机型)性能可以达到663w+的tpmC,多节点扩展性线性度超过0.8。其核心架构关键词如下:计算,内存,存储三层分离式
一、使用VMware安装Ubuntu虚拟机推荐可以再下个Xshell用于操作终端。Xshell免费版官网下载地址:https://www.xshell.com/zh/free-for-home-school/二、伪分布式平台搭建Part1:准备工作首先按 ctrl+alt+t 打开终端窗口,输入如下命令创建新用户。这条命令创建了可以登陆的hadoop用户,并使用/bin/bash作为shell。sudouseradd-mhadoop-s/bin/bashsudo命令:本文中会大量使用到sudo命令。sudo是ubuntu中一种权限管理机制,管理员可以授权给一些普通用户去执行一些需要root权限
一、使用VMware安装Ubuntu虚拟机推荐可以再下个Xshell用于操作终端。Xshell免费版官网下载地址:https://www.xshell.com/zh/free-for-home-school/二、伪分布式平台搭建Part1:准备工作首先按 ctrl+alt+t 打开终端窗口,输入如下命令创建新用户。这条命令创建了可以登陆的hadoop用户,并使用/bin/bash作为shell。sudouseradd-mhadoop-s/bin/bashsudo命令:本文中会大量使用到sudo命令。sudo是ubuntu中一种权限管理机制,管理员可以授权给一些普通用户去执行一些需要root权限